Vice President: Software Engineering
2 days ago
Why Entersekt
Founded over 16 years ago, with more recent investments from Accel-KKR, Entersekt is a leader in digital banking fraud prevention and payment security, including mobile authentication, mobile app security, and 3-D Secure authentication for issuers, acquirers and payment networks. We offer highly scalable products with a track record of success across multiple continents.
Entersekt enables secure digital transactions for leading financial institutions globally. We exist to create a world where everyone can transact digitally without fear or compromise. Currently, we protect the digital transactions of over 210 million active users on our platform and hold 120 active patents that recognize innovation in digital security, payments, and user experience. Entersekt offers customers secure authentication and digital payments experiences that remove unnecessary friction. Entersekt has a diverse product portfolio and aggressive roadmap that positions the company well to sustain competitive advantage as it expands globally with emphasis on North America and European markets.
The Ideal Candidate
You're a senior engineering leader who has modernised software delivery at scale and knows how to drive consistent engineering excellence across multiple product teams. You've led transformations involving CI/CD, test automation, progressive delivery, AI-enabled engineering practices, and cloud-native architectures.
You're comfortable influencing a matrixed organisation, setting standards, and guiding POD leaders without direct line authority. You balance engineering rigour, risk management, and speed, while partnering closely with Product, Architecture, Security, and Platform Engineering.
You enjoy driving clarity, structure, and governance in environments that are scaling quickly, and you have a strong track record of bringing consistency to engineering processes while enabling innovation and autonomy.
The Role
The VP of Software Engineering is accountable for enterprise-wide engineering standards, release governance, toolchain strategy, and AI-driven engineering transformation across our product development PODs.
This role serves as the central owner of the SDLC, quality gates, metrics, release patterns, architectural governance, and engineering operating model. It drives alignment across PODs without initially taking direct line management of engineering team leads, but with clear authority to define, enforce, and continuously improve engineering practices.
You will partner closely with POD Leaders, Product, Architecture, SRE/Platform Engineering, Information Security, and GRC, ensuring our products meet high standards of reliability, security, compliance, and delivery consistency, all while embedding modern engineering practices across the SDLC.
Responsibilities
- Cross-Functional Leadership
- Operate as a matrixed leader: influence POD Leaders, Product Management, Architecture, SRE/Platform, and InfoSec; chair an Engineering Standards Council to ratify and evolve practices.
- Budget for and govern vendor relationships and tooling investments; establish business cases for modernization.
- Engineering Governance & Standards
- Define, publish, and enforce the enterprise SDLC and development standards (branching, code review, secure coding, documentation), including POD consistent Jira workflows, states, and entry/exit criteria from ideation through production.
- Establish Definition of Ready/Done for features and defects; set predevelopment conditions of success expected from Product before work begins.
- Create quality gates (unit, component, functional, nonfunctional) and observability baselines and ensure they are uniformly applied across PODs.
- Define, monitor, report and implement strategies to continuously improve software engineering and delivery metrics (e.g., FLOW, DORA).
- Release & Deployment Management
- Institutionalize separation of deployment from release to reduce risk and improve flexibility; standardize feature flag usage, canary and progressive delivery patterns, and kill switches for rapid rollback.
- Codify roles: Engineering ensures predictable, automated deployments; Product owns feature exposure decisions and business rollout strategy.
- Align with ITIL 4 guidance that treats Release and Deployment as distinct practices with different objectives.
- Quality Engineering & Test Automation
- Lead the shiftleft transformation so software developers own unit, component, and functional tests within PODs; QA evolves to enablement, tooling, and governance.
- Oversee automation frameworks, self-service test platforms, and AI assisted test generation, flakiness detection, and impact analysis in CI/CD.
- Directly manage the Quality Manager and scale a small excellence function to drive consistency, training, and audits.
- AI-Driven Engineering Transformation
- Build an AI adoption roadmap across the SDLC: AI assisted coding & reviews, test generation, defect triage, vulnerability remediation, documentation, and intelligent planning/estimation; implement guardrails for privacy, security, and provenance.
- Partner with Platform/SRE to embed AI augmented developer experience and insights into internal developer portals and pipelines.
- Compliance, Security & Risk
- Embed securebydesign practices and evidence collection to meet SOC 2 Criteria and PCI DSS/3DS requirements; leverage control overlaps to streamline audits and reduce burden.
- Partner with Cybersecurity/GRC to ensure policy→control→evidence alignment in code scanning, dependencies, secrets management, and change control.
- Architecture Governance & Enablement
- Define and enforce architectural standards for scalable, secure, and compliant systems across PODs.
- Partner with Principal Engineers, Lead Engineers, Platform Engineering, and Security to ensure cloud-native, API-first, and secure-by-design principles are embedded in all product lines.
- Support POD-level autonomy while ensuring architectural decisions align with enterprise patterns and compliance requirements (e.g. SOC 2, PCI DSS, PCI 3DS).
- Leverage AI tools to assist with architectural documentation, impact analysis, and dependency management.
- Authority & Decision Rights
- Approve and enforce the enterprise SDLC, Jira workflows, and quality gates.
- Approve standards and block releases that fail to meet defined engineering gates or compliance requirements.
- Own toolchain standards (GitLab/Jira/Confluence/Jellyfish) and require corrective actions for noncompliant usage.
- Set policy for feature flag governance (naming, lifespan, cleanup) and progressive rollout patterns.
Skills and Experience
Successful candidates for this role will generally possess the following qualifications and skills:
- 10+ years in software engineering with 5+ years in senior leadership roles in SaaS, platform engineering, or large-scale product organisations.
- Proven experience influencing matrixed teams and driving engineering transformation.
- Demonstrated success modernising engineering practices (CI/CD, progressive delivery, observability).
- Hands-on experience with GitLab-based secure CI/CD and Jira-integrated planning at scale.
- Deep understanding of engineering intelligence and metrics-driven leadership (including DORA).
- Experience in compliance-heavy environments such as fintech or authentication.
- Practical experience applying secure-by-design practices in regulated or audited contexts.
- Track record implementing AI-enabled engineering practices.
- Training or experience in Agile, DevOps, Architecture, or ITIL is advantageous.
- Bachelor's degree in computer science, Software Engineering, or a related field (mandatory).
- Master's degree in computer science, Engineering, or Business Administration (MBA) preferred.
SUCCESS MEASURES (12–18 MONTHS)
- Engineering Governance: A single, documented SDLC with PODconsistent Jira workflows, entry/exit criteria, and quality gates is adopted across all products; auditready by design.
- Progressive Delivery: Separation of deployment and release is standardized with feature flag governance and stagegated rollouts (internal → % canary → full), with clear responsibilities between Product (release decisions) and Engineering (deployment reliability).
- AI Enabled SDLC: AI assists coding, testing, planning, and documentation; measurable cycletime improvements and reduction in toil are achieved responsibly and securely.
- Toolchain & Metrics: GitLab, Jira, Confluence, and Jellyfish are standardized and integrated for traceability and engineering intelligence; DORA metrics dashboards report lead time, deployment frequency, change failure rate, and time to restore.
- Compliance by Design: Engineering practices demonstrably align with SOC 2 and PCI DSS/3DS controls with efficient evidence capture and control mapping.
Personality Attributes
- Strong influencer able to drive change without relying on direct authority.
- Structured, analytical thinker with a rigorous approach to engineering governance.
- Comfortable navigating complexity and aligning multiple stakeholders.
- Able to balance engineering quality, delivery speed, and product outcomes.
- Confident communicator who can translate engineering standards into clear expectations.
- Pragmatic, objective decision-maker who values data, metrics, and transparency.
- Comfortable leading in high-growth, fast-paced, and compliance-oriented environments.
We place a lot of value on how we treat prospective employees and appreciate the time and effort that goes into job hunting. That is why we aim to keep the hiring process as quick and seamless as possible while ensuring the best possible fit for both you and the company.
Working at Entersekt is truly a dream. You get exposed to cutting-edge technology, colleagues who are leaders in their fields, and an awesome working environment that includes flexible hours, remote work, and plenty of growth opportunities.
Apply for this position by following the "apply now" tab and or viewing our other roles at Entersekt Careers page.
Entersekt is an Equal Opportunity Employer:
We are committed to building an inclusive and diverse workforce that reflects the global communities we serve. For all South Africa-based roles, preference will be given to candidates from historically disadvantaged groups, in accordance with local Employment Equity objectives.
-
Vice President
1 week ago
Johannesburg, Gauteng, , South Africa Copper Quail Full time R250 000 - R500 000 per yearJob Title: Vice President - Finance (EMEA) Location: Johannesburg, South AfricaAn established company is seeking anexperienced VP of Finance to lead its finance operations, oversee riskmanagement, governance, financial planning, and ensure compliance across theSouth African and EMEA region. You will play a key role in the strategicfinancial management of the...
-
Assistant Vice President, Development
4 days ago
Partial Remote, Bethlehem, South Africa Lehigh Full time US$145 000 - US$163 430 per yearJoin Lehigh University's dynamic Development team and shape the future of philanthropic excellence We're seeking a visionary Assistant Vice President to provide strategic leadership for our fundraising programs, focusing on corporate and foundation relations while advancing the College of Health, College of Education, and University Research Centers &...
-
Senior Software Engineer
1 week ago
Johannesburg, South Africa iDbase Software Full timeAbout the Role We are seeking an experienced Senior Software Engineer (Java) to join our innovative technology team. You will design, build, and maintain scalable enterprise-grade applications using Java and complementary technologies. This role emphasizes cloud-native development, microservices architecture, and secure, high-performance coding practices. It...
-
Software Engineer
1 week ago
Johannesburg, South Africa iDbase Software Full timeAbout the Role We are seeking an experienced Software Engineer (.NET & AWS) to join our innovative technology team. You will design, build, and maintain scalable enterprise-grade applications, leveraging modern .NET technologies and AWS cloud services. This role emphasizes cloud-native development, microservices architecture, and secure, high-performance...
-
Senior Software Engineer
1 week ago
Johannesburg, South Africa iDbase Software Full timeAbout the Role We are seeking an experienced Senior Software Engineer (.NET & Azure) to join our innovative technology team. You will design, build, and maintain scalable enterprise-grade applications leveraging modern .NET technologies and Microsoft Azure cloud services. This role emphasizes cloud-native development, microservices architecture, and secure,...
-
Vice President 1
7 hours ago
South Africa EXL Full time R1 200 000 - R1 800 000 per yearDescriptionEssential FunctionsProcess Transition. Manage transition of processes with end-to-end accountability. Establish strong communication and governance plan.Transition Review. Conduct reviews with external and internal business leaders on overall transitions planning and execution to ensure that program and project implementations are meeting or...
-
Software Engineer
1 week ago
South Africa takealot Full time R250 000 - R500 000 per yearJoin Our Mission at Takealot Fulfilment Solutions | We Are TFSRevolutionising e-commerce logistics in South Africa with cutting-edge technology and operational excellence. We deliver 30+ million orders annually, empowering businesses and driving economic growth.Who We're Looking For:Innovative, ambitious individuals ready to shape the future of e-commerce...
-
Software Engineer
4 days ago
South Africa Takealot Group Full time R1 000 000 - R3 000 000 per year, South Africa's leading online retailer, is looking for a highly talented Software Engineer (Python) to join our team. We are a young, dynamic, hyper-growth company looking for smart, creative, hard-working people with integrity to join usThink you've been challenged before? Think againScale: Over 4 million happy shoppers shop online on Show them what you...
-
Software Engineer
4 days ago
South Africa takealot Full time R500 000 - R1 200 000 per year, South Africa's leading online retailer, is looking for a highly talented Software Engineer (Python) to join our team. We are a young, dynamic, hyper-growth company looking for smart, creative, hard-working people with integrity to join usThink you've been challenged before? Think againScale: Over 4 million happy shoppers shop online on Show them what you...
-
Software Engineer
4 days ago
South Africa Takealot Group Full time R250 000 - R500 000 per year, South Africa's leading online retailer, is looking for a highly talented Machine Learning Engineer to join our team. We are a young, dynamic, hyper-growth company looking for smart, creative, hard-working people with integrity to join us Think you've been challenged before? Think againScale: 4 million happy shoppers shop online on and 2.7 million on Mr...